AERT 145
Introduction to Drone-UAS Technology
New Mexico State University-Main Campus ·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Introduction to drone or Unmanned Aircraft System (UAS) technology and its applications in architecture, engineering, construction, film, media, and other related industries. Best practices, training, permissions, licensing, and documentation requirements will be explored. Obtaining, working with, and managing data obtained by drones will be emphasized. Emerging technologies and future applications will be introduced. Restricted to Dona Ana Campus only.
